Daily Inspiration Quote by Sharon Gless

"In my early days I was a contract player at Universal and I had a wonderful mentor named Monique James, who was head of talent there, and she used to drag me on sets to do parts"

About this Quote

There is a quiet politics in the way Sharon Gless frames her origin story: not as a lone-genius ascent, but as something engineered by proximity, advocacy, and a little force. “Contract player at Universal” plants her firmly inside the old studio ecosystem, where careers were less DIY brand-building than managed inventory. The phrase carries a double edge: security and constraint, a paycheck and a leash.

Then she drops the real power center: Monique James, “head of talent,” a title that reads like bureaucracy until you hear what follows. “Wonderful mentor” is the socially acceptable label; “used to drag me on sets” is the reveal. Drag is an active verb. It implies urgency, insistence, a mentor willing to spend social capital to get a young actress seen doing actual work, not just waiting politely for permission. The subtext is that opportunity doesn’t “open”; it gets pried open by someone who already has keys.

The line “to do parts” is modest on its face, almost throwaway, but that understatement is the point. She’s describing the unglamorous mechanics of becoming known: small roles, quick assignments, being useful. It’s a counter-myth to the starlet discovered in a flashbulb moment. Gless is telling you that talent matters, but placement matters more - and that behind many “breaks” is a gatekeeper who decided to intervene.
